Gibiers, Game, a design by Henri de Linares, has achieved what some might say GRAIL status despite its subject matter, becoming quite coveted by collectors.

The enduring appeal of Henri de Linares’ Gibiers likely stems from the artist’s meticulous rendering of the hunting trophies and his masterful layering of the composition.

Born in 1904, Linares was a prolific French artist renowned for his exquisite depictions of this subject matter.

His still life drawings, lifelike (the irony not withstanding), filled with such incredible detail, are reminiscent of paintings of the early 17th century Northern Renaissance artists. But luckily for us, we do not have to spend thousands to have one of those, we have the beautiful Gibiers Hermes carre, which is not just the ideal accessory but can easily double as a gorgeous wall display.
